update listener model

This commit is contained in:
Tanishq Dubey 2025-01-31 18:49:44 -05:00
parent 0436d6e24a
commit 682cdfa95c

View File

@ -284,7 +284,8 @@
}); });
}); });
function saveChanges(button) { function saveChanges(event) {
const button = event.target;
const row = button.closest('tr'); const row = button.closest('tr');
const photoId = row.dataset.id; const photoId = row.dataset.id;
const updatedData = {}; const updatedData = {};
@ -313,9 +314,9 @@
alert('An error occurred while saving changes.'); alert('An error occurred while saving changes.');
}); });
} }
function deletePhoto(event) {
function deletePhoto(button) {
if (confirm('Are you sure you want to delete this photo?')) { if (confirm('Are you sure you want to delete this photo?')) {
const button = event.target;
const row = button.closest('tr'); const row = button.closest('tr');
const photoId = row.dataset.id; const photoId = row.dataset.id;
@ -336,10 +337,8 @@
alert('An error occurred while deleting the photo.'); alert('An error occurred while deleting the photo.');
}); });
} }
} document.getElementById('delete-btn').addEventListener('click', (event) => deletePhoto(event));
document.getElementById('save-btn').addEventListener('click', (event) => saveChanges(event));
document.getElementById('delete-btn').addEventListener('click', deletePhoto);
document.getElementById('save-btn').addEventListener('click', saveChanges);
document.getElementById('profile_image_upload').addEventListener('change', async (e) => { document.getElementById('profile_image_upload').addEventListener('change', async (e) => {
const file = e.target.files[0]; const file = e.target.files[0];